    Dana

    Not surprisingly, the 2011 Cabernet Sauvignon Lotus Vineyard (308 cases of 100% Cabernet Sauvignon that was aged 20 months in new French oak) is a lighter style, but it is a successful effort from this vineyard’s decomposed, rocky, volcanic soils. Well-made with no herbaceousness, it offers pretty blueberry and raspberry flavors intertwined with wet rocks, spring flowers and background oak. Bottled early to preserve its fruit, it should be enjoyed over the next 10+ years.

    -Robert Parker

    Region: Paso Robles, California


    Blend: 81% Cabernet Sauvignon, 13% Cabernet Franc, 6% Petit VerdotRobert Parker - 95 Points

    "The 2020 Soul Of A Lion, made from free-run juice, is a blend of 80% Cabernet Sauvignon, 13% Cabernet Franc and 7% Petit Verdot matured for 22 months in 100% new French oak. It has a deep ruby color and pure aromas of blackcurrants, tobacco, truffle and thyme with touches of leather and graphite. The full-bodied palate has a pleasantly rustic texture and savory character, finishing with tobacco accents. Drink it over the next 3-5 years."


    Antonio Galloni - 96 Points

    "The 2020 Soul of a Lion Estate is a deep, dark, nearly impenetrable ruby color. It has a beguiling bouquet that blends spicy dried flowers, cardamon and red currants. Sweet smoke hints add lift. This flows like pure silk without a single edge in sight. Guided by juicy acidity, textural waves of wild berry fruits soothe the palate. For all of its power and depth, the 2020 finishes remarkably fresh. It’s tannic, yet they are sweet and perfectly formed in a harmonious concentration that tugs at the senses yet never tires them out. The cellaring potential here is off the charts."
